Khasab: During a meeting on Monday, the Musandam Governorate Municipal Council addressed a request to grant government land under usufruct rights to construct a commercial and recreational complex, as well as the allocation of future investment areas for food security in the governorate.
During the meeting, chaired by Sayyid Ibrahim Said Al Busaidi, Governor of Musandam and Chairman of the Municipal Council, the council debated a plan to promote investment activities for mountain community inhabitants (beehives) as well as a request to set aside land for the construction of model cattle and poultry farms.
The council also considered plans to begin the addressing project in Khasab and to relocate warehouses from Khasab Port to the Mahas Industrial Area.
Furthermore, the council welcomed a delegation from the Housing and Urban Planning Department to review the residential and commercial master plan for the Daiyr area in the Wilayat of Madha.
